Turtle Art is programmed to produce two different frequency sounds. The headphone output of the XO is connected to a pair of LM567 tone decoders, each of which lights a LED when its input signal frequency is present. With this principle we could control any device based on the frequency emitted by the XO. | Turtle Art is programmed to produce two different frequency sounds.
